Sports fans net Compass a 21% surge in revenues
Evening Standard
|July 25, 2023
COMPASS the caterer has reported a surge in revenues of more than a fifth as it continues to cash in from the return of workers to offices and crowds to sporting events.
The FTSE 100 multi-national, which this month fed thousands of spectators at the Wimbledon tennis championships said today that organic revenue growth over the nine months to the end June was 21%.
Wimbledon is one of its 55,000 sites at which Compass serves about 5.5 billion meals a year. Canteen food has been used by employers to tempt people back to the office after the end of Covid lockdowns.
